Earlier this week, this was confirmed The Last of Us Part 1 It will arrive on PC on March 3, 2023. It wasn’t known if it would work on the Steam Deck, but Naughty Dog’s Neil Druckmann is out It confirmed that the game will indeed support Steam Deck. This isn’t much of a surprise considering all other PlayStation ports have Steam Deck support so far. However, this will be an interesting test of the capabilities Steam Deck has to offer Part 1 It was built for the PS5, which means it will be more graphically intense than the PS3 and PS4 versions of the game. It’s quite the sights already, so it should probably push the Steam Deck to its limits.

The Last of Us Part 1 It’s also a pretty cinematic game, so it’s probably best experienced from the comfort of your own home, but there’s nothing wrong with trying it on the Steam Deck. Only time will tell how successful it will actually be, but it will ensure that the game is expanded to a new audience beyond PlayStation and casual PC gamers. With the upcoming TV show airing just before the PC release, The Last of Us will be more relevant than ever in 2023.
